Overview
Electrical and Electronics Engineering at Istanbul Aydin University prepares candidates for academic careers, advanced research positions, and high level engineering leadership roles. The program begins with advanced doctoral coursework in specialized areas such as advanced power systems, renewable energy integration, smart grids, advanced control systems, signal processing, communication systems, electromagnetics, microelectronics, embedded systems, and digital system design. These courses deepen theoretical understanding and strengthen analytical modeling skills.

A strong emphasis is placed on research methodology, advanced mathematical modeling, experimental design, simulation techniques, and scientific publication standards. Doctoral candidates receive training in quantitative analysis, computational modeling, and data interpretation to support high quality research output. After completing coursework and qualifying examinations, candidates proceed to the dissertation phase. The doctoral dissertation represents an original contribution to knowledge in electrical and electronics engineering. Research areas may include smart energy systems, wireless communication technologies, advanced signal processing algorithms, power electronics, robotics and automation, semiconductor device modeling, or embedded system innovation.
